In a cowardly act of sabotage, the Khawarij attempted to destroy a strategically important link bridge in the Miryan area of Bannu, causing partial damage to the structure. The targeted bridge, located near Amir Ghafor Korona in the Norar locality, served as a vital connection between Jani Khel and Bannu city. It has been frequently used by law enforcement and intelligence agencies for operational movement in the region.
According to security sources, the Khawarij planted explosives to sever this key route and disrupt the mobility of security forces. Although the bridge sustained partial damage, the attempt to fully demolish it was unsuccessful. Swift deployment of bomb disposal and security teams helped secure the area and prevent further harm.
“This was a calculated attempt by the Khawarij to hinder state operations and spread fear among the local population. Their failure reflects the unwavering vigilance and preparedness of our security forces,” a senior official said on condition of anonymity.
Following the incident, law enforcement agencies launched a search and clearance operation in the surrounding areas to apprehend those involved. Surveillance measures have also been intensified along sensitive routes.
Authorities have vowed that such subversive acts will not be tolerated and reaffirmed their commitment to eliminate the Khawarij menace. Immediate assessments are underway to repair the damaged portion of the bridge and restore full connectivity.
